  1. My PC still doesn't support Windows 11 although turning on TPM 2.0 and Secure Boot.


    Hi everyone, as you all know turning TPM 2.0 and Secure Boot on is necessary to install Windows 11. Although turning them both on, Windows Update still has the "This PC doesn't currently meet the minimum requirements to run Windows 11." warning. There is no problem when I check PC Health Check application. I checked whether I turned on TPM 2.0 or not correctly by using "tpm.msc" command and I can see that the Specification Version is 2.0, I also checked System Information if Secure Boot is on or off and it is on as well. I own a Gigabyte H410M-H motherboard with an Intel i3-10100F processor. M

    Welcome to Ten Forums.


    There are some more requirements that the PC Health app checks besides secure boot and TPM 2.0. There is a list of supported processors too.
